In most cases of prognathism, a combination of maxillofacial surgery and orthodontic treatment is used to correct the malocclusion, or misalignment, of the jaws. Depending on the type and severity of the condition, the procedure may involve surgical modification to one or both of the jaws. The tongue locates forward and is larger than normal in prognathism, in which the jaw protrudes from the skull. Underbite (also known as undershot, reverse scissor bite, prognathism, Class 3, or Mandibular mesioclusion): the lower jaw is excessively long, longer than the upper one and the lower teeth protrude in front of the upper teeth. Usually prognathism occurs with a smaller jaw, so the smaller jaw may be made slightly longer, while the larger jaw is set back.
